Diced Lamb Pide
Oven-baked pide with diced lamb, peppers and tomato, finished with a brush of butter.
Open in recipe finder →Time110 min
Servings4
LevelMedium
Caloriesapprox. 680
Ingredients · for 4 servings
500 g flour
1 packet yeast
300 ml lukewarm water
1 tsp sugar
1 tsp salt
500 g lamb meat
2 green long peppers
2 tomatoes
1 onion
1 tbsp red pepper paste
60 g butter
1 tsp Aleppo pepper flakes
Instructions
- Dissolve the yeast with the sugar in the lukewarm water, let foam for 10 min., knead with flour and salt into a smooth dough and let rise covered for 60 min.; cut the lamb into 1 cm cubes.
- Finely dice the onion, seed and finely chop the long peppers, peel and dice the tomatoes.
- Thoroughly mix the meat, onion, peppers, tomatoes, red pepper paste, Aleppo pepper flakes, salt and pepper in a bowl and let sit for 20 min. so the meat absorbs the seasoning.
- Preheat the oven with the tray inside to 250 °C, quarter the dough and roll each piece into a narrow oval about 30 cm long.
- Spread the meat mixture down the middle without the released juices, fold the long edges over it and pinch the ends firmly into points.
- Bake for 12–15 min. until the edge is golden brown and the meat is just cooked through, then brush with the melted butter and serve hot cut into strips.
